Current research on sleep using experimental animals is limited by the expense and time-consuming nature of traditional EEG/EMG recordings. We present here an alternative, noninvasive approach utilizing piezoelectric films configured as highly sensitive motion detectors. These film strips attached to the floor of the rodent cage produce an electrical output in direct proportion to the distortion of the material. During sleep, movement associated with breathing is the predominant gross body movement and, thus, output from the piezoelectric transducer provided an accurate respiratory trace during sleep. During wake, respiratory movements are masked by other motor activities. An automatic pattern recognition system was developed to identify periods of sleep and wake using the piezoelectric generated signal. Due to the complex and highly variable waveforms that result from subtle postural adjustments in the animals, traditional signal analysis techniques were not sufficient for accurate classification of sleep versus wake. Therefore, a novel pattern recognition algorithm was developed that successfully distinguished sleep from wake in approximately 95% of all epochs. This algorithm may have general utility for a variety of signals in biomedical and engineering applications. This automated system for monitoring sleep is noninvasive, inexpensive, and may be useful for large-scale sleep studies including genetic approaches towards understanding sleep and sleep disorders, and the rapid screening of the efficacy of sleep or wake promoting drugs.

In the framework of health services research sponsored by the Swiss National Science Foundation, a research was undertaken of the activity of the large majority of the public health nurses working in the Swiss cantons of Vaud and Fribourg (total population 700,000). During one week, 130 nurses gathered, with a specially devised instrument, data on 4165 patient visits. Studying the duration of the contacts, one has distinguished contact duration per se (DC), duration of the travel time preceding the contact (DD), and total duration in relation with the contact (DTC-addition of the first two). It was noted that the three durations increased significantly with patient age (as regard travel time, this is explained by the higher proportion of home visits in higher age groups, as compared with visits at a health center). Examined according to location of the visit, contact duration per se (without travel) is higher for visits at home and in nursing homes than for those taking place at a health center. Looked at in respect to the care given (technical care, or basic nursing care, or both simultaneously), our data show that the provision of basic nursing care (alone or with technical care) doubles contact duration (from 20 to 42-45'). The analyses according to patient age shows that, at an advanced age (beyond 80 years particularly), there is an important increase of the visits where both types of care are given. However, contact duration per se shows a significant raise with age only for the group "technical care only"; it can be demonstrated that this is due to the fact that older patients require more complex technical acts (e.g., bladder care, as compared with simpler acts such as injection). A model of the relationships between patient age and contact duration is proposed: it is because of the increase in the proportions of home visits, of visits including basic nursing care, and of more complex technical acts that older persons require more of the working time of public health nurses.

RésuméCette thèse s'intéresse à l'impact du niveau d'éducation sur les attitudes envers les mesures de discrimination positive en faveur de la promotion professionnelle des femmes. La littérature consacrée à cette relation présente des résultats inconsistants : certains travaux ne montrent que l'éducation n'a pas d'effet sur l'accueil réservé aux mesures positives, tandis que d'autres suggèrent que cette relation pourrait être influencée par la nature des mesures positives. Nos attentes s'appuient sur les thèses de l'effet libérateur et de l'effet reproducteur de l'éducation. Les études réalisées dans le cadre de cette thèse, menées auprès de cadres, d'employés et d'étudiants résidant en Suisse et en Albanie, mettent en évidence un lien négatif entre le nombre d'années d'études et l'acceptation des mesures positives. Toutefois, cet effet apparaît essentiellement dans le cas de la mesure favorisant l'appartenance groupale des candidates par rapport à leurs caractéristiques personnelles, et non pas dans le cas de la mesure s'appuyant sur les compétences et le mérite des candidates. Nos études mettent en évidence les mécanismes qui génèrent ces opinions : l'orientation à la dominance sociale, l'adhésion aux principes méritocratiques, la reconnaissance de la discrimination subie par les femmes et le sentiment de menace généré par la mise en place des mesures de discrimination positive. Ces études examinent également la perception plus ou moins stéréotypée des bénéficiaires des mesures positives et de leur vulnérabilité aux conduites d'auto-handicap. Dans l'ensemble, les résultats corroborent davantage la thèse de l'effet reproducteur de l'éducation que celle de l'effet libérateur de l'éducation.

Interleukin 1 beta (IL-1 beta) is a potent proinflammatory factor during viral infection. Its production is tightly controlled by transcription of Il1b dependent on the transcription factor NF-kappaB and subsequent processing of pro-IL-1 beta by an inflammasome. However, the sensors and mechanisms that facilitate RNA virus-induced production of IL-1 beta are not well defined. Here we report a dual role for the RNA helicase RIG-I in RNA virus-induced proinflammatory responses. Whereas RIG-I-mediated activation of NF-kappaB required the signaling adaptor MAVS and a complex of the adaptors CARD9 and Bcl-10, RIG-I also bound to the adaptor ASC to trigger caspase-1-dependent inflammasome activation by a mechanism independent of MAVS, CARD9 and the Nod-like receptor protein NLRP3. Our results identify the CARD9-Bcl-10 module as an essential component of the RIG-I-dependent proinflammatory response and establish RIG-I as a sensor able to activate the inflammasome in response to certain RNA viruses.

In contrast to mice from the majority of inbred strains, BALB mice develop aberrant Th2 responses and suffer progressive disease after infection with Leishmania major. These outcomes depend on the production of Interleukin 4, during the first 2 d of infection, by CD4+ T cells that express the Vbeta4-Valpha8 T cell receptors specific for a dominant I-A(d) restricted epitope of the LACK antigen from L. major. In contrast to this well established role of IL-4 in Th2 cell maturation, we have recently shown that, when limited to the initial period of activation of dendritic cells by L. major preceding T cell priming, IL-4 directs DCs to produce IL-12, promotes Th1 cell maturation and resistance to L. major in otherwise susceptible BALB/c mice. Thus, the antagonistic effects that IL-4 can have on Th cell development depend upon the nature of the cells (DCs or primed T cells) targeted for IL-4 signaling.

The paper first sketches out a reply to the underdetermination challenge and the incommensurability challenge that rebuts the sceptical conclusions of these challenges and that is sufficient to lay the ground for the project of a metaphysics of nature. That metaphysics is as hypothetical as are our scientific theories. The paper then explains how can one can argue for certain views in the metaphysics of nature based on our current fundamental physical theories, namely the commitments to a tenseless theory of time and existence instead of a tensed one, to events instead of substances, and to relations instead of intrinsic properties. Finally, the paper mentions the themes of causation, laws and dispositions.
